All of these shock platforms are in completely different leagues and are not equal? King's IBPs aren't really IBPs IMO.....only internal needle valves for the last 2" of bump travel where Fox and ADS are literally multi zone internal bypasses that each zone is individually tunable.

A lot of it is smoke and mirrors! People seem to pick a brand based on color or other cool factor, then they want me to work around it assuming they already bought them?

Why not pick your tuner based on your use and their experience. Let the tuner sell you what really need? I send some people to Phil at Liberty Mountain Fab if their driving style and use don't align with my personal experience and philosophy, but it does with his.

I've driven a diesel JT on Accutuned Fox resi 2.0's......it failed the drive test before I finished backing out of my parking space......the owner was laughing that I was already bagging on his truck in less than 15'.

After driving my truck, the guy wrote me a check for a set of my tuned Fox 2.5s. 100% of the people who actually drive in to the shop and get to try my truck for themselves buy either the E-Cliks or Fox 2.5s with my tuning. One guy came back for a small tweak a couple of weeks later to soften it up, but the dozens of others have been happy as I delivered them.

This stuff is a stupid amount of money for many people and that's why I'm kind of excited for the possibilities of the HTO 2.5. Something that's more robust and should last 50-100% longer AND is rebuildable by someone other than just Fox!
